Bus Tickets from Niagara-on-the-Lake to Toronto

Previously seen trips

Next departures for Niagara-on-the-Lake to Toronto on November 7
Operated byVehicle typeDeparture timeDeparture locationTrip durationArrival timeArrival locationRecommendedPrice and booking link
FlixBus
    Niagara-on-the-Lake
    Union Station Bus TerminalNo tags
    FlixBus
      Niagara-on-the-Lake
      Union Station Bus TerminalNo tags
      FlixBus
        Niagara-on-the-Lake
        Union Station Bus TerminalNo tags
        FlixBus
          Niagara-on-the-Lake
          Union Station Bus TerminalNo tags
          FlixBus
            Niagara-on-the-Lake
            Union Station Bus TerminalNo tags

            Compare 2 ways to go from Niagara-on-the-Lake to Toronto

            We recommend taking the bus

            Among the sustainable travel choices, the bus stands out as the good way to reach Toronto. The journey takes about 1 hour 50 minutes and with fares starting at just $14, it presents an excellent value for a comfortable ride.

            1bus per day
            1h 50mAverage Duration
            32 milesDistance
            1kgCO₂ emissions
            Average Price$14 - $21Average Duration1h 50m
            1kg CO₂e
            Carpool
            Average Price$17 - $22Average Duration1h 45m
            2kg CO₂e

            Frequently asked questions about traveling from Niagara-on-the-Lake to Toronto by bus

            What's the cheapest way to go from Niagara-on-the-Lake to Toronto?

            busbud logoThe bus is the cheapest travel choice for this destination

            Why choose Busbud?

            The Best Way To Book Bus and Train Tickets

            Busbud helps you easily search, compare and book intercity bus tickets on a worldwide scale with our comprehensive list of bus routes and schedules. With Busbud, wherever you go, you have a worldwide bus station within reach and available in your own language and currency. With Busbud, you can buy tickets with confidence. We ensure that you make the most out of your bus trip by partnering up with reliable bus companies from all around the world such as Greyhound, Eurolines, ALSA, OUIBUS (BlaBlaBus), National Express and many others.

            People from around the world trust Busbud

            Popular Buses Connecting Niagara-on-the-Lake

            Buses Leaving from Niagara-on-the-Lake

            Buses Going to Niagara-on-the-Lake

            Popular Buses Connecting Toronto

            Buses Leaving from Toronto

            Buses Going to Toronto